Babies seem to be able to escape serious illnesses thanks to genetic manipulation during their design. For example, Made in the United Kingdom. however, this experience could not have taken place in France or in the United States in the face of strict regulation in this area.

Published Wednesday evening in the New England Journal of Medicine. Nevertheless, a study, eagerly awaited by the scientific community, takes stock of unprecedented experience: around twenty women have received a “mitochondria gift” in order to avoid transmitting a rare genetic disease to their child.

Mitochondria is a small structure present in our cells and plays an engine role by converting energy nutrients.

In some cases – one in 5,000 people – Mitochondria works badly. Moreover, It therefore causes a “mitochondrial” disease which can result in various research too limited embryo? major ways. In addition, often heavy and disabling: vision disorders, diabetes, muscle degeneration …

However, these mitochondria work from special DNA, distinct from the rest of the cell. Nevertheless, The idea of the donation of mitochondria is therefore. However, just after the design of an embryo, to replace the mitochondrial DNA of the mother with that of another woman. Therefore, All the rest of the genetic material remains that of both parents.

For some commentators. Moreover, these are “babies to three parents” even if this term, often used by opponents of this procedure, is far from being unanimous among specialists in the subject, who deem it caricatured.

The United Kingdom is a pioneering country in this area: the donation of mitochondria has been authorized there since 2015. which has enabled the experience whose results have just been published.

They are, in the opinion research too limited embryo? major of several scientists, very encouraging. Out of twenty patients, eight gave birth to children, now between six months and three years old.

This already shows that the donation of mitochondria allows a viable pregnancy. But, above all, these children were born with a very low rate of compromise mitochondrial DNA. An illustration that the treatment “works to reduce transmission” of mitochondrial diseases, concludes the study.

Several precautions are required. First, two children experienced medical complications. The authors believe that it is not linked to the procedure. but some commentators judge that they exclude him a little quickly.

Above all. since their birth, three of the children have already seen their rate of defective mitochondria increase, which raises the question of the sustainability of the effects.

However. these are “very important and a breakthrough in mitochondrial research too limited embryo? major medicine”, for the Swedish professor Nils-Göran Larsson, one of the world specialists in the field, in a reaction to the British Media Center.

The fact remains that scientific advance is not the only one to be the subject of positive comments. This is also the case of the regulation chosen by the United Kingdom. praised by many researchers for having allowed this research while supervising it closely from an ethical point of view.

This choice contrasts with many other countries. In the United States, health authorities have regularly expressed their opposition in recent years. In France. the Biomedicine Public Agency has sought to launch research, but has encountered justice several times when bioethical laws authorize experiences only on embryos of less than two weeks, from a PMA and doomed to destruction.

The donation of mitochondria poses, in fact, ethical questions. Some observers fear that research too limited embryo? major the procedure. introducing a dose certainly reduced by DNA of a third person, disturbs the child in the development of his personality.

Above all. criticisms underline that this is a form of genetic manipulation of the embryo, firmly prohibited by certain international conventions.

In addition. out of the British experience, children have been born in recent years of Mitochondria donations in a less restrictive regulatory framework, in Greece or Ukraine, with a sometimes more vague justification as to treat infertility.

“This is the problem of the benefit/risk ratio: for a mitochondrial disease. the benefit is obvious,” said French researcher Julie Steffann, specialist in mitochondrial disease with AFP. “As part of infertility, it is not proven.”

But the ban on research in France “is regrettable for patients. ” she said, deeming inadequate to see the donation of mitochondria to the creation of a research too limited embryo? major “transgenic” embryo
